The Cardinals extended their winning streak to 13 games. They managed to stay in front of New Glarus and beat them 68-60. Ron Jorgensen sunk 21 points while Sid Wheeler and Dick Kneubeuhl made 14 apiece. Brodhead failing to convert on free throws suffered its first set back of the season to a tough Monticello five 74-76. Brodhead trailed. throughout the whole game up to the last quarter when they tied the score at 72 all. From there on the lead changed hands. Ron Jorgenson and Sid Wheeler took scoring honors 'with 20 points apiece. After losing their first game, the Cardinals came back strong to stop Blanchardville 69-55. Center Ron Jorgenson paced the team with 24 points and Sid Wheeler followed him with 20 points. The Brodhead five out scored Albany in the first three quarters to coast to an easy 69-57 victory. The Cardinals played very sharpe offensive ball but lacked in defense. Sid Wheeler led the team with 24 points and Ed Ruef collected 12 points. The Cardinals found themselves behind at half time 26-25. But they staged a rally in the second half to whip Brooklyn 74-40. lew Wheeler dropped in 19 points with Ron Jorgenson leading the team with 20 points. Iuda nearly upset Brodhead by a score of 49-47. .Iuda fell in the final minute of play to the Cardinals. Brodhead played one of its poorest games of the year with l.ew Wheeler and Ed Meichtry scoring 12 points each. Dick Wolters started his first game and proved that he could handle the guard spot very well. Brodhead's Cardinals had no trouble stopping the Viking by a score of 63-48. Sid Wheeler took scoring honors in the league as well as for the team with 35 points. The reserves took part in this game as they have others through out the season. They are Roger Wichelt, Dick Walter, Gary Engle, and Eon Olson, Gary Ringen was out for the season with Yellow Iauntice. Coach Appels team lost their last conference game and the right to share the State Line title with Monticello. Belleville defeated the Cardinals 56-54. Sid Wheeler collected 26 points for Brodhead. Ronald Schwartzlow, Coach Warren Selbo. BASKETBALL GAMES The Brodhead Cardinals opened their 1956-57 basketball season by defeating Evansville E4-49. Sid and Lewis Wheeler led the team with 19 and 16 points respectively. Dick Kneubeuhl, Ed Meichrry and Ron Jorgenson, three sophomores helped get the victory. The Cardinals opened league play by defeating a weak Argyle team 50-27. Sid Wheeler led Brodhead with 16 points. Brodheads very strong zone defense held Argyle to 4 points the first half. Brodhead won its second conference game of the season by defeating a strong and determined Monticello five 52-48. Brodhead trailed up to the third quarter and then a see-saw battle filled out the remainder of the game with Brodhead forging ahead. Ron Iorgenson took scoring honors with 18 points followed by Sid Wheeler and Ed Ruef with 15 and 12 respectively. The Cardinals won their fourth straight game from Milton Union by a score of 56-39. Ron Jorgenson dumped in 19 points for the victors. Brodhead traveled to Albany for their third conference win 70-55. Ron Jorgenson led the scoring with 22 points followed closely by Dick Kneubuehl with 18. Brodhead won their sixth straight game from New Glarus 65-55. The Cardinals have a well balanced attack as the first six players scored five or more points. Sid Wheeler and Dick Kneubeuhl each scored 16 points. Brodhead held off a late rally to defeat a scrappy Blanchardville quintet 74-62. The game was close most of the way with Brodheads offense the big gun of the game. Ron Iorgenson took scoring honors with 23 points followed by Lewie Wheeler with 21 markers. The Cardinals chalked up a victory over Orfordville 69-45. The team, got off to a slow stan but proved to be to much for the Vikings. With 25 points Ron Jorgenson led the Cardinals followed by Sid Wheeler with 15. Brodhead didn't play their best ball against Brooklyn. but they won the game by a score of 51- 32. Ron Iorgenson collected 17 points and Ed Ruef 13 to lead the Cardinals to victory. Brodhead beat Juda 57-31 for their tenth consecutive win in 10 starts. Ron Iorgenson took scoring honors with 16. followed by Dick Kneubuehl and Lewie Wheeler with 10 and 9 points respectively. Brodhead ran over a weak Argyle team 74-40 for our eleventh straight win. The game was roughly played as all of Argyles first five had four fouls or more. Ron Jorgensen took scoring honors with 27, followed by Ed Ruef and Lewis Wheeler with 12 and 11 points respectively. ' Brodhead, showing their determination of league leaders defeated a tough Belleville five 64-61. ltxstarted out as if Belleville would walk awayxwith it but the Cardinals regained their offensive touch to down the visitors. Lewie Wheeler topped Brodheads scoring with 19 points followed by Ed Ruef with 16.
